Phonon spectrum, thermal expansion and heat capacity of UO2 from first … WebThis code can help you calculate linear thermal expansion coefficients (LTECs) by Gruneisen theory, based on first-principles calculations. It needs phonon spectra for only several volumes, and can applied to 2D/3D, anisotropic/isotropic materials. Note the calculation is based on the results of VASP and Phonopy. It is based on Python 2.7.
